Texto completoMinion- an orderly friend in the common laundry room The common laundry room. A service to society that everyone takes for granted or an arena for bad behavior. In either case, it is a place where cheating with cleaning up after yourself as well as hijacking appointments and stealing other people’s belongings can lead to really serious fights that are reported to the police. Changing the common laundry room and keeping a waking eye on it, costs a lot of money something that not everyone has access to. Under these circumstances, the problems found there will simply go on existing until all common laundry rooms are shut down. Research has proven that pictures of eyes can counter act behaviors similar to the ones causing trouble in the common laundry room. These pictures cause an unconscious feeling of being watched that will correct such behaviors either by creating consciousness of the bad behavior or the fear of being caught and then punished. As pictures of eyes have such a severe effect on us, an interactive robot with eyes, a voice and a kind personality will have the same effect as well as reinforce the feeling of being watched. Minion is a small interactive robot that keeps the common laundry room’s visitors company while being its patron. Minion’s main task is to remind the visitors that they are never there alone and can therefore counteract such bad behavior that is reinforced in secluded spaces. Minion succeeds in doing so by having the ability to communicate, sing, dance, eat fluff from the drier and recount facts about the world and its own life. Even while being silent it causes the same feeling of being watched for the ones being in the common laundry room with it. Unfortunately the existing prototype is that only of a shell and not a fully functional robot, as of which Minion’s functions had to be explained through pictures and reenactments during the user study that was made. Minion was embraced with excitement and approval and the case study proved that all of Minion’s functions are relevant as well as completely fulfilled. Minion could be further developed to other areas of daily life where an interactive robot could be of some use, such as in improving the quality of life for people in need of a companion.

Texto completoAlthough rarer than in animals, separate sexes (dioecy) have evolved in ∼15,600 angiosperm species (∼6% of all angiosperm species). How sex is controlled is a central question in plant sciences and also in agronomy as many crops are dioecious (∼20% of crops) with only one useful sex (usually female). Only three master sex-determining genes have been identified in dioecious plants so far, namely in persimmons, asparagus and strawberry. Dioecy likely evolved several times independently in angiosperms, suggesting that sex-determining genes are of diverse origins. Hermaphroditism is the predicted ancestral state of the angiosperm flower. Two main pathways have been identified that explain the evolution of hermaphroditism towards dioecy: either through a monoecious state (with both unisexual male and female flowers on the same individual) or a gynodioecious state (with females and individuals having hermaphroditic flowers). My aim is to compare two plant systems representing each one of these two pathways. In Coccinia grandis, a Cucurbitaceae with an XY chromosome system, dioecy evolved through monoecy. In Silene latifolia, a well-studied dioecious plant with XY sex chromosomes, dioecy evolved through gynodioecy. Three genes controlling monoecy have been identified in melon, and it was suggested that these genes act as sex-determining genes in closely related dioecious species such as C. grandis. I therefore chose a candidate gene approach in this species. Very few genetic and genomic data are available in C. grandis, and we chose to use SEX-DETector, a probabilistic method that uses RNA-seq data to genotype parents and their offspring, and infers sex-linked genes with no need for a reference genome. This method allowed me to identify 1,364 genes that are present on the sex chromosomes of C. grandis. I found that the sex chromosomes are enriched in sex-biasedgenes when compared to autosomes and I characterized Y chromosome degeneration in terms of decreased expression and gene loss. Finally, I showed that dosage compensation occurs in C. grandis. Testing for the three candidates genes is ongoing. In S. latifolia 3 regions involved in sex determination have already been identified on the Y chromosome. We chose to sequence this chromosome to identify sex-determining genes. The sequencing of Y chromosomes remains one of the greatest challenges of current genomics. The assembly step is very difficult because of their highly repeated content. Consequently, fully sequenced Y chromosomes are rare and mainly available for research in animals. To overcome the difficulty of assembling reads with many repeats, I used third generation sequencing (TGS, producing long reads). I produced a dataset using the Oxford Nanopore MinION sequencer with Y chromosome DNA. Assembling was performed using a combination of Illumina, MinION and PacBio sequencing data. The final assembly had a total length of 563 Mb with a scaffold N50 of 6,114 bp, and contained 16,219 de novo annotated genes

Texto completoAs times change, the behaviour of mass and way of thinking remain the same. Mass is still relying on irrational solutions, ideas and is controlled by various emotions. Absurd fanatic manifestations overcome the critical mind of an individual. Nowadays, in the Lithuanian culture, one of the most prominent display of the mass fever can be recognised in basketball fans that cheer, shout patriotic slogans and tend to turn basketball players into idols. In contemporary art this theme is not overlooked – the relation between basketball and the society is constantly being analysed, as well as the change of its meaning in different periods of time. The object of work. The cycle of three painting works – portraits of fans. The theme of the work focuses on this mass phenomenon, analyses the main features of the mass and helps to evaluate own goals more consciously.
